- Believed to be the son of Francis Innever/Enever & Elizabeth Freeman. Susan Elizabeth Enever is living with Maria Enever at 43 St Mary Axe in 1851 after the death of her mother & is recorded as her niece. 43 St Mary Axe is also the address given by Ann Enever, John's daughter, when she married George Wheal in 1850. Eliza, John's wife, was probably born Fyfield or Chipping Ongar, the area where Francis's other children were born.
Francis & Elizabeth's first 2 children were baptised in a non-conformist church and it appears that several later children were not baptised.
